/* SPDX-License-Identifier: GPL-2.0-or-later * Copyright 2011 Blender Foundation. All rights reserved. */ /** \file * \ingroup cmpnodes */ #include "UI_interface.h" #include "UI_resources.h" #include "COM_node_operation.hh" #include "node_composite_util.hh" /* **************** Double Edge Mask ******************** */ namespace blender::nodes::node_composite_double_edge_mask_cc { static void cmp_node_double_edge_mask_declare(NodeDeclarationBuilder &b) { b.add_input(N_("Inner Mask")).default_value(0.8f).min(0.0f).max(1.0f); b.add_input(N_("Outer Mask")).default_value(0.8f).min(0.0f).max(1.0f); b.add_output(N_("Mask")); } static void node_composit_buts_double_edge_mask(uiLayout *layout, bContext * /*C*/, PointerRNA *ptr) { uiLayout *col; col = uiLayoutColumn(layout, false); uiItemL(col, IFACE_("Inner Edge:"), ICON_NONE); uiItemR(col, ptr, "inner_mode", UI_ITEM_R_SPLIT_EMPTY_NAME, "", ICON_NONE); uiItemL(col, IFACE_("Buffer Edge:"), ICON_NONE); uiItemR(col, ptr, "edge_mode", UI_ITEM_R_SPLIT_EMPTY_NAME, "", ICON_NONE); } using namespace blender::realtime_compositor; class DoubleEdgeMaskOperation : public NodeOperation { public: using NodeOperation::NodeOperation; void execute() override { get_input("Inner Mask").pass_through(get_result("Mask")); } }; static NodeOperation *get_compositor_operation(Context &context, DNode node) { return new DoubleEdgeMaskOperation(context, node); } } // namespace blender::nodes::node_composite_double_edge_mask_cc void register_node_type_cmp_doubleedgemask() { namespace file_ns = blender::nodes::node_composite_double_edge_mask_cc; static bNodeType ntype; /* Allocate a node type data structure. */ cmp_node_type_base(&ntype, CMP_NODE_DOUBLEEDGEMASK, "Double Edge Mask", NODE_CLASS_MATTE); ntype.declare = file_ns::cmp_node_double_edge_mask_declare; ntype.draw_buttons = file_ns::node_composit_buts_double_edge_mask; ntype.get_compositor_operation = file_ns::get_compositor_operation; nodeRegisterType(&ntype); }
